About The Guillebeau House

The Guillebeau House, located in McCormick County, South Carolina, is a historic residence that stands as a testament to the architectural and cultural heritage of the region. This beautifully preserved home, often referred to as the "Guillebeau House," is a fine example of early 19th-century Southern architecture, reflecting the traditions and craftsmanship of its time.

Elijah Clark State Park Road

4.5km from The Guillebeau House

Elijah Clark State Park is a beautiful nature park provides visitors with the opportunity to explore beautiful woodlands surrounded by breathtaking lake views. At the park, visitors can enjoy activities such as boating, fishing, swimming, and camping that are all made possible thanks to the sprawling 1,053 acres of land. There are also many trails to take a leisurely stroll or a more thrilling mountain bike ride on and over 50 campsites available throughout the park.

Parsons Mountain

26.05km from The Guillebeau House

Parsons Mountain, located in Abbeville, is a natural treasure waiting to be explored by outdoor enthusiasts and nature lovers. This scenic mountain, part of the Sumter National Forest, offers a serene escape from the hustle and bustle of city life and provides a wealth of recreational opportunities in a pristine wilderness setting.Rising to an elevation of approximately 832 feet, Parsons Mountain offers visitors breathtaking vistas of the surrounding landscape.
